Transfer CreditWestminster College accepts credit earned at other regionally accredited institutions in which a C- or better has been earned and which is appropriate for the degree being sought. Courses that are remedial in nature or below college level are not acceptable. A maximum of 72 credit hours may be awarded from two-year institutions. A maximum of 88 credit hours may be awarded from a combination of 2- and 4-year institutions. NOTE: It is not possible to earn upper-division credit hours from a 2-year institution. New transfer students are issued a Transfer Evaluation Summary by the Registrar’s Office. These summaries are also prepared each time a student transfers credit to Westminster.
